Milled ilmenite ore with acid leaching process. Two grams of acid milled-I sample was subsequently used in acid leaching process using 100 ml 50% sulfuric acid operated at 95 °C for 6 h under continuous magnetic stirring. The solid residue was separated from slurry sample by centrifuge and washed with DI water for several times.

Minerals, slags, and other feedstock for the production of titanium

Natural rutile was the feedstock of choice at the early years of the Kroll process, but nowadays it comes in limited supply. Titanium dioxide slags are produced by reduction smelting of ilmenite in electric arc furnaces. The slag grade (sulfate or chloride) depends essentially on the quality of the ore or concentrate fed to the slag furnaces.

A brief introduction to production of titanium dioxide and titanium

Ilmenite can also be converted to a more pure titanium dioxide product using the Becher process. This process consists of high-temperature exposure to oxygen in air to convert ilmenite to pseudobrookite: 4FeTiO 3 + O 2 = 2Fe 2 O 3 TiO 2 + 2TiO 2. The oxidation process oxidizes the iron and allows it to form a separate iron oxide phase.

Processing titaniferous ore to titanium dioxide pigment

A hydrometallurgical process is provided for producing pigment grade TiO 2 from titaniferous mineral ores, and in particular from ilmenite ore. The ore is leached with a hydrochloric acid, preferably a recycled solution at high hydrochloric acid concentration, to form a leachate containing titanium and iron chloride and a residue. Ilmenite for pigment and metal production

Chlorination method. DuPont in USA [4] produces the pigment since 1950 by direct chlorination of ilmenite ore, separation of products by fractional distillation, then oxidation of TiCl4 (Figure 10): Figure 10: Simplified Du Pont process for pigment production from ilmenite. 2FeTiO3 + 7Cl2 + 3C → 2TiCl4 + 2FeCl3 + 3CO2.
